WebThe completed Form 211, along with evidence or other documentation supporting the claim, must be submitted under penalty of perjury to the IRS Whistleblower Office. The process may take many years. Awards will be paid only if the IRS is successful in pursuing the claim and has collected the money it is due. Instead, a whistleblower should … WebThe Internet can be a helpful tool for choosing the best whistleblower attorney for you. You should be aware, however, that some websites misrepresent law firms’ experience and success representing whistleblowers. There also are websites that target whistleblowers and look like they are put up by lawyers, when actually they belong to referral ...
